On Mon, Jul 06, 2026 at 12:35:39AM +0300, Laurent Pinchart wrote:
> Since DDC version 2, introduced in 1996, VGA monitors have exposed EDID
> data over an I2C bus. The bus is also used to detect the presence of a
> connected monitor by trying to read the EDID data.
>
> Some devices where the VGA display is integrated in the device and
> always connected do not connect the DDC pins. Some development boards,
> such as the Renesas M3N Salvator-XS, also do not connect the DDC pins.
>
> To support those, add the ability to provide hardcoded EDID data in the
> device tree. This is mutually exclusive with specifying a DDC bus, and
> can only be done when the VGA display is guaranteed to be always
> connected.
